glassblower

/ˈɡlæsˌbloʊər/
noun
  1. A person who shapes hot, melted glass by blowing air into it through a tube to create objects such as bottles, vases, or ornaments.
    • My aunt visited a studio where a glassblower was making colorful paperweights.
    • The glassblower carefully rotated the molten glass on the end of the pipe.
    • The museum hired a skilled glassblower to demonstrate the ancient craft to visitors.
